Technology development pathways addressed were: distribution enabled technologies; transmission enabled technologies (renewable energy); nuclear technology development and deployment; advanced coal with cO{sub 2} capture and storage; and estimated funding needs for technology pathways. Four major conclusions emerge from these studies: the strategy for reducing sector emissions will be technology-based; a diverse portfolio of advanced technologies will be required; significant RDD and near- and long-term RD&D activities will be needed to enable significant emissions reductions. 11more » refs., 13 figs., 3 tabs.« less
